Example #1
0
        public static string DownloadVideo(string url)
        {
            ISYMMSettings settings = new SYMMSettings(url, Properties.Settings.Default.SavePath, Mode.Single, Properties.Settings.Default.DefaultVideoResolution, Properties.Settings.Default.DuplicateChecking);
            Backend.Execute(settings);

            // No direct output. Command feedback comes from backend.
            return "";
        }
Example #2
0
        public static string StreamAudio(string url)
        {
            ISYMMSettings settings = new SYMMSettings(url, Actions.Stream, Mode.Single, Properties.Settings.Default.DefaultAudioBitrate);
            Backend.Execute(settings);

            // No direct output. Command feedback comes from backend.
            return "";
        }
Example #3
0
        public static string DownloadAudio(string url)
        {
            ISYMMSettings settings = new SYMMSettings(url, Properties.Settings.Default.SavePath, Actions.ExtractAudio, Mode.Single, Properties.Settings.Default.DuplicateChecking, (AudioFormats)Enum.Parse(typeof(AudioFormats), Properties.Settings.Default.DefaultAudioFormat, true), Properties.Settings.Default.DefaultAudioBitrate);
            Backend.Execute(settings);

            // No direct output. Command feedback comes from backend.
            return "";
        }